Based on the ingredient list

Yes. Yes, Neutrogena Hand Cream Concentrated is silicone-free.

No silicones in the list. We checked every name ending in methicone, siloxane or silanol.

Why

Silicones give slip and a smooth finish. On a label they end in methicone, siloxane or silanol: Dimethicone, Cyclopentasiloxane, Amodimethicone.
